The WK Kellogg Co. Data Breach: Reported Filing Facts
WK Kellogg Co. is a prominent food manufacturing and consumer goods company that manages extensive supply chains and human resources operations. As a large-scale employer and manufacturer, the company typically collects and stores sensitive personal information, including employee payroll data, tax documentation, and government-issued identification numbers. In 2025, the company officially reported a data security incident to the New Hampshire Attorney General, confirming that unauthorized access to their systems occurred. If you have received a formal data breach notification letter from the company, it indicates that your personal information was likely stored within their network at the time of the incident. This notice is intended to inform you of the nature of the breach and the specific steps the company is taking to address the exposure of your private data.

What to do if you were affected
These general steps can help limit the risk of identity theft and fraud after any data breach.
Stay alert to targeted scams
Be cautious of calls, texts, or emails that reference this breach. Legitimate organizations won't ask you to confirm sensitive details through an unsolicited message.
Keep your notification letter
Save the notice you received. It documents that your information was involved and is often needed to enroll in any credit monitoring offered or to join a related legal claim.
